A solo exhibition featuring 45 works, Pure Satire features most recent work created by Maleonn in China and Europe. Known for his colourful theatrical approach using props and actors, Maleonn is one of the most prominent contemporary photographers in China. Born in a family of artists, Maleonn started as a creative director in the advertising industry, who later decided to follow his true calling as an artist 8 years ago. He often describes his art as an oniric work built like a poem "of the fragments of things without any logic", with dream like characters, random mix of old and new, and simply vivid imagination that life is like a theatre, and hidden stories untold. Maleonn has exhibited internationally and participated in critical showcase including Shanghai Biennale 2010 and Reshaping History, 2000-2009 Chinese New Art . This is his second solo exhibition in Singapore since 2005 at Jendela Gallery, Esplanade.
